nismochi's pic shows area well -all the cam +crank pulley removal isnot necessary though .best to get a checklist noting exactly what was removed in order + anything to remark as special attention .the two short hoses better be replaced - water pump also would besmart to replace (I beleive it needs to be loosened or removed here) .One potential headache is one of the stubby bolts(w/rubber inserts) which holds left timing cover half interferes slightly with outlet of waterpump you gotta get creative , angle parts , shave length off a little,etc. but it can be done - or if you don't install that bolt it's not the endof the world either ! don't overtork anything going into aluminum/magnesium and youll be ok permatex water outlet silicone sealer is good specially made -non contaminating or corrosive stuff forthis job (w/pump and/or thermo) good luck .......
